    It was my first time coming here and I already know I'll be a regular! It's a classic cool dive bar with amazing food and incredibly friendly staff. Everything we had last night was so amazing. I highly recommend the fried green tomatoes, they are a huge portion and the most unique twist on crab + fried green tomatoes I've ever had the pleasure of tasting. I've heard Silk's has some legendary cheesesteaks, and after last night, I know why! The classic Silk's cheesesteak was stuffed, piping hot, with plenty of cheese, pepper, and onion. I split with my fiancée and I'm coming back just so I can have a cheesesteak all to myself. We also shared the mushroom Swiss burger, which was a classic burger that was really tasty, but nothing to write home about. The fries, however, are seriously some of the best fries I've had in Baltimore. They're a fun curly shape, they're crispy on the outside and moist on the inside, and they give you a huge portion.

    4 of us met up on a Saturday around 5pm for dinner and WOW. The bartender doubles as the waiter, so that service was a tad slow, but he did a good job checking in on us. He was happy to help us watch the football game we wanted. The menu is straight forward and accessed via QR code. In total at the table, we ordered the Memphis Mac n Cheese, Shrimp and Grits, and 2 burgers. Everyone devoured their entire meals - talk about delicious. I had the mac n cheese and it was the perfect amount of creamy. There was a good amount of the BBQ pork which was nice. The shrimp and grits were delish too with the sausage mixed in. I don't normally like grits but the sauce and cheese made it delectable. They have a good amount of beers on tap and a full bar. I would happily come here again. Note that this is in a typical corner store type place for the city, so parking is a premium, but we had no issues parking nearly in front of the restaurant at the hour.

    Update: we just went to brunch at silks for the first time and it blew my mind! Fave chicken and waffles in the city now. Everything was amazing, breakfast cheesesteak, banana caramel chocolate pancakes!? Come on. Wow. Bartender/server was also so attentive and friendly. Can't wait to come back ASAP. Silks is our new go to happy hour spot! We were just there today and the bartender was so friendly and attentive. We have had the wings before but had to order them again. each time I am reminded how awesome they are, large, crispy and still juicy. Love that honey old bay! We saw someone else at the bar with the buffalo chicken tenders and had to o those too, so big and delicious! Silks is the only bar I know that has sidewinder fries and they are a Game Changer. Sweet potato fries are really good too, thicker than most other places. The pork mac & cheese should not be missed and the cheesesteak with wiz is so bomb! (Many places don't have the wiz and they always disappoint) Can't beat $1 domestics at happy Hour. We will be back very soon!
